Late 19th century French clock garniture, gilt metal mantel clock with serves style porcelain urn above ribbon tie cresting, circular painted porcelain Roman dial, two painted columns enclosing centre panel depicting two cherubs in country setting, wreath, masks and scrolled acanthus leaf decoration, on scrolled supports, twin train 'A.D. Mougin' movement striking the hours and half on coil, and pair matching vase shaped porcelain and gilt metal garnitures, all on shaped moulded gilt wooden plinths, presentation plaque inscribed '...Rev X.P. Airen... St. Barnabas Church Openshaw... September 1882...', H55cm

AN EBONISED BRACKET CLOCK the break arch silvered Roman dial with Arabic five minutes, the arch inscribed Thos. Morgan, Edinburgh with strike/silent, regulation dials and date aperture at 6 o'clock, the whole with foliate scroll engraving, the six pillar movement with pull repeat, bell strike with floral urn, bird and scroll engraved back plate, the inverted bell top case with three pineapple finials, twin side handles over glazed windows, the door with gilt metal mounts upon brass ogee bracket feet, 53cm high
A GEORGE III MAHOGANY BRACKET CLOCK the break arch silvered Roman dial with Arabic five minutes signed Henry Taylor, London with strike/silent ring to the arch, the twin train fusee movement with anchor escapement, bell strike and covered urn floral and acanthus scroll engraved back plate, the triple pad top break arch case with carrying handle, brass fish scale side frets upon ogee brass bracket feet, 42cm high handle down
